In the Footbrake class, old pro Lowell Bowen of Millerville, AL took
the win over Tyler, Alabama racer Darryl Driggers. Bowen's classic '55
Chevy ran a 7.178 ion his 7.14 dial at 87.28 miles per hour for the
win. Driggers dialed a 7.53 but his '71 Nova fell off to a 7.583 at
88.31 miles per hour in a losing cause.
